Area-specific

Local Considerations

  • Hillside grading affects runoff toward streets and foundations
  • Hot summers demand water-efficient irrigation zones
  • Soil composition varies from rocky slopes to established lawns
  • Seasonal storms require erosion control and mulch refreshes
Before you hire

Homeowner Guidance

  • Request a drainage plan with elevation notes and water-path mapping
  • Compare irrigation proposals by controller type, zones, and water savings
  • Ask for plant warranties and a seasonal maintenance schedule
  • Confirm retaining wall specs, footing depth, and drainage behind walls
  • Get written timelines for phased installs and ongoing lawn care
